Summary, etc. |
<p style="text-align: justify;">The three component condensation reaction of aldehydes with dimedone and ammonium acetate or anilines happened in the presence of Ag nanoparticles as a heterogeneous catalyst at room temperature in ethanol.Ag nanoparticles can suitably be handled and removed from the reaction mixture, generating the experimental process simple and green.The significant features of this method are suitable conversions, cleaner reaction profiles and short reaction time. The catalyst is recycled and reused for five successive times without loss of structure and significant activity.</p> |
